Workshop discusses promotion of Kashmiri kehwa

SRINAGAR: A workshop and stakeholders’ meeting on the promotion of Kashmiri kehwa was held at the Directorate of Agriculture, Lalmandi, on Thursday, with officials and industry representatives discussing strategies to expand the traditional beverage’s presence in domestic and international markets.

The programme was jointly organised by the Tea Board of India and the Agriculture Department, Kashmir, and was inaugurated by Director Agriculture Kashmir Sartaj Ahmad Shah.

The event was attended by Joint Director Extension Kashmir Mujtaba Yehya, representatives of the Agricultural and Processed Food Products Export Development Authority (APEDA), tea stakeholders and officials of the Tea Board of India.

According to officials, discussions focused on promoting Kashmiri kehwa through coordinated efforts between the Tea Board of India and the Agriculture Production and Farmers Welfare Department, Kashmir, with the aim of increasing its visibility and market reach at the national and international levels.

Speaking at the workshop, Shah said the initiative could create new opportunities for local entrepreneurs, producers and traders associated with the kehwa trade. He noted that the beverage’s growing popularity and perceived health benefits offered potential for expansion into wider markets.

He said the Agriculture Department would continue efforts to support local entrepreneurs by facilitating marketing linkages and promoting products with export potential.
